Amersham Station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ey for travellers. While there is no dedicated ticket office, there are ticket machines available to cater to your ticketing needs. Unfortunately, accessibility support for these machines is limited, so it is advisable to have your tickets sorted in advance when possible.
Help and support are readily available, with staff on hand Monday to Friday from 06:00 to 19:00. Although a help point is available, customer help points are conspicuous by their absence. For any luggage storage concerns, it should be noted that there are no facilities for this service.
The station is equipped with step-free access throughout, making it accessible for those with mobility needs. While accessible toilets and waiting rooms are not available, passengers can make use of a drop-off point on the station forecourt for easy pick-up and drop-off.
If you’re in need of some refreshment, limited options are available nearby, but there are no ATM, shop, or currency exchange services at the station. For cyclists, there are 56 bicycle storage spaces available, complete with a CCTV-secured area adjacent to the station entrance.
Seamlessly connect to other modes of transport directly from Amersham Station. Taxis are readily available just outside the station for convenient travel. For those using bus services, rail replacement buses depart from bus stop J on Hill Avenue, ideally situated opposite Tesco. Amersham is linked via the Metropolitan Line, providing easy access to Central London and its rich tapestry of offerings. If you're catching a flight, you can interchange in Central London to access Gatwick, Heathrow, Stansted, and London City airports.
